Use Compound Interest Monthly Formula:
A = P(1 + r/n)^nt
A = Future Amount
P = Initial Amount
r = Interest rate
n = monthly
= 12 months
t = 15
In this case:
P = 2500
r = 7.8%
n = 12 months
t = 15 years
7.8% = 7.8/100
= 0.078
2500(1 + 0.078/12)^12(15)
= 8024.54 —> Final Answer.

Given:
Adam's locker has a password that consists of 4 non-repeated letters from A - Z.
To find:
The number of different passwords.
Solution:
Total number of letters from A - Z is 26.
So, the number of selecting a letter for first place is 26.
The passwords consists non-repeated letters. So, the remaining numbers is
.
The number of selecting a letter for second place is 25.
Similarly,
The number of selecting a letter for third place is 24.
The number of selecting a letter for fourth place is 23.
The total number of possible different passwords is:

Therefore, the total number of different passwords is 358800.
